51143125 has 40 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 71752032. Its totient is φ = 36120000.
The previous prime is 51143119. The next prime is 51143137. The reversal of 51143125 is 52134115.
It is a happy number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 51143125 - 25 = 51143093 is a prime.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 51143096 and 51143105.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 39 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 295539 + ... + 295711.
Almost surely, 251143125 is an apocalyptic number.
51143125 is a gapful number since it is divisible by the number (55) formed by its first and last digit.
It is an amenable number.
51143125 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(20608907).
51143125 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
51143125 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 247 (or 232 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its digits is 600, while the sum is 22.
The square root of 51143125 is about 7151.4421622495. The cubic root of 51143125 is about 371.1895607642.
The spelling of 51143125 in words is "fifty-one million, one hundred forty-three thousand, one hundred twenty-five".
